Accessing public records in Grant, MT
Grant is not incorporated with a local government but is designated as populated area by the US Census. As a result public records are held by the Beaverhead County court and the county clerk's office. Records related to criminal offenses are also held by Beaverhead County Sheriff's Office.
The below state agencies will also hold records for Grant residents.
Montana Secretary of State: Maintains records related to business entities, including corporate filings, trademarks, and trade names.
Montana Department of Public Health and Human Services: Provides access to vital records such as birth certificates, death certificates, marriage certificates, and divorce records.
Montana Department of Corrections: Provides access to records related to incarcerated individuals, including inmate records and prison information.
Montana Department of Justice: Manages records related to criminal history information, including background checks and arrest records.
